Jamia Millia Islamia (JMI) has announced that it will resume the offline classes for all students except for the first-year students from July 16. The varsity has advised all the deans of faculties to complete the renovation, maintenance and repair works of classrooms and laboratories before the classes commence. 

The official notification stated that "the Vice-Chancellor, JMI (Najma Akhtar), on the recommendation of the Dean of Faculties has approved to reopen the university in offline mode from July 16, 2022, for all classes except 1st semester/Year."

The varsity had resumed the offline classes for the final year postgraduate and final year, undergraduate students, in March. While physical classes were resumed for final year students, the first and second-year undergraduate students and first-year post-graduate students have been attending classes online until now.

The offline classes for the final-year postgraduate student began on March 2, and for final-year undergraduate students resumed in mid-March.  On March 2, three dry canteens at the varsity were also opened with the permission of the registrar. 

Meanwhile, the Department of Tourism and Hospitality Management (DTHM), Jamia Millia Islamia (JMI) began  the “HUNAR SE ROZGAR TAK” (HSRT) Programme, an initiative by the Ministry of Tourism, GOI. The program aims to create employable skills among youth and helping students in upgrading the skills relevant to the hospitality and tourism sector in the country. With the launch of this program, DTHM, JMI has provided a comprehensive platform to the students who have no career options as such but have dreams in their eyes to be skilful and eventually employable, said the official statement.
